protected void BUCallBackPanel_Callback(object sender, CallbackEventArgsBase e) { ASPxPageControl pageControl = BUDeptListGrid.FindEditFormTemplateControl("BUHeadPageControl") as ASPxPageControl; ASPxComboBox entCode = pageControl.FindControl("EntityCode") as ASPxComboBox; ASPxCallbackPanel callBackPanel = pageControl.FindControl("BUCallBackPanel") as ASPxCallbackPanel; ASPxComboBox buCode = callBackPanel.FindControl("BUCode") as ASPxComboBox; buCode.Value = ""; buCode.Text = ""; DataTable dtRecord = GlobalClass.EntBUSSUTable(entCode.Value.ToString()); buCode.DataSource = dtRecord; //ListBoxColumn l_value = new ListBoxColumn(); //l_value.FieldName = "ID"; //l_value.Caption = "ID"; //buCode.Columns.Add(l_value); //ListBoxColumn l_text = new ListBoxColumn(); //l_text.FieldName = "NAME"; //l_text.Caption = "Name"; //buCode.Columns.Add(l_text); buCode.TextField = "NAME"; buCode.ValueField = "ID"; buCode.TextFormatString = "{1}"; buCode.DataBind(); }
private void BindUserList() { //MRPClass.PrintString("MRP is bind"); DataTable dtRecord = GlobalClass.BUDeptHeadTable(); BUDeptListGrid.DataSource = dtRecord; BUDeptListGrid.KeyFieldName = "PK"; BUDeptListGrid.DataBind(); }
protected void BUDeptListGrid_StartRowEditing(object sender, DevExpress.Web.Data.ASPxStartRowEditingEventArgs e) { bindHeadList = false; sEntCode = BUDeptListGrid.GetRowValues(BUDeptListGrid.FocusedRowIndex, "EntityCode").ToString(); sBUCode = BUDeptListGrid.GetRowValues(BUDeptListGrid.FocusedRowIndex, "BUDeptCode").ToString(); }